当运行python3 main.py文件时出现错误,可能是由于以下原因导致的:
- 语法错误:检查代码中是否存在拼写错误、缩进错误、括号不匹配等语法问题。可以使用Python的语法检查工具,如pylint或flake8,来帮助发现并修复这些错误。
- 缺少依赖库:如果代码中使用了第三方库或模块,但未在环境中安装,会导致错误。可以通过使用pip命令安装所需的依赖库,例如:pip install <库名>。
- 文件路径错误:检查main.py文件的路径是否正确。确保文件存在于指定的位置,并且路径在代码中正确引用。
- 版本不兼容:某些Python代码可能依赖于特定的Python版本。确保你正在使用与代码兼容的Python版本,并且已经安装了所需的Python解释器。
- 环境配置问题:检查是否正确设置了Python环境变量,并且所需的库和模块在环境中可用。
如果以上方法都无法解决问题,可以尝试以下步骤:
- 查看错误信息:运行时错误通常会提供有关错误的详细信息,包括错误类型和错误发生的位置。仔细阅读错误信息,以便更好地理解问题所在。
- 调试代码:使用调试器工具,如pdb或PyCharm等,逐行执行代码并观察变量的值,以找出错误的原因。
- 搜索解决方案:在互联网上搜索类似的错误信息,查找其他开发者遇到过类似问题的解决方案。可以参考Python官方文档、Stack Overflow等技术社区。
总结:当运行python3 main.py文件时出现错误,需要仔细检查代码语法、依赖库、文件路径、Python版本和环境配置等方面的问题。如果问题仍然存在,可以使用调试工具进行逐行调试,并在互联网上搜索解决方案。